Amazon Redshift dialect for sqlalchemy.
- pysocpg2 >= 2.5
- SQLAlchemy 0.8
DSN format is simpilar to that of regular postgres:
from sqlalchemy import create_engine
engine = create_engine("redshift+psycopg2://[email protected]:5439/database"
Currently, contraints and indexes return nothing when intropecting tables. This comes from the redshift implementation of the postgresql api == 8.0